Ronnie Stanley (ankle) 'should be ready' to return for training camp

by Matthew MacKay | Ravens Correspondent | Wed, Jan 20th 4:38pm EST

Ravens OT Ronnie Stanley (ankle) "should be ready" to return for the Ravens' training camp after suffering a season-ending ankle injury back in Week 8, as reported by Jamison Hensley. (Jamison Hensley on Twitter)

Fantasy Impact:

Stanley was not available down the stretch for the Ravens which made a significant difference, particularly against the Buffalo Bills in the Divisional Round. Lamar Jackson was held to 34 rushing yards while getting sacked three times and failing to score in any capacity due to defenders continuously disrupting the pocket from his blind-side. The fifth-year tackle suffered a fractured and dislocated ankle mid-season but is expected to fully recover and return by training camp, which bodes well for Lamar Jackson and the rest of the Baltimore offense heading into the 2021 season.
